Factors Affecting Cost
House raising in Hammond, IN, involves elevating a structure to protect against flooding, facilitate foundation repairs, or improve property value. The scope and complexity of a house raising project can vary based on several factors, including materials, size, and local permitting requirements. Understanding typical project considerations can help homeowners plan effectively and compare options.
- Materials: The process generally involves using steel or timber supports, with the existing foundation and framing being key components.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small single-story homes to larger multi-story structures, influencing the overall effort and resources needed.
- Labor Complexity: House raising requires careful coordination of lifting, stabilization, and reconstruction, often involving specialized equipment and techniques.
- Permitting: Local Hammond permits are typically required to ensure compliance with building codes and regulations related to structural modifications.
- Additional Services: Extra considerations may include foundation repairs, utility disconnects and reconnects, and site cleanup after the raising process.
